Content and presentation continue to evolve on TV as well. The show s famously catchy theme song, Sunny Day, now has a hip-hop beat and a jazzier arrangement. Parente stresses that it s just as important to keep our curriculum current. The ABC s and 123 s are always there, but we stay relevant by incorporating other things that are interesting and meaningful.
We focus on all aspects of development cognitive needs, social and emotional needs, health needs and bring in advisers who are experts in each area, to make sure we re age-appropriate, says Rosemarie Truglio, vice president of education and research, Sesame Workshop. But we never talk down to children, and we re not afraid to explore sensitive topics.
Sesame has had its critics in the academic community as well.
For Mary Lynn Crow, a clinical psychologist and professor of education at the University of Texas-Arlington, shows like Sesame Street lack the potentially deep, personal emotional imprint that can and should occur between a student and teacher in an early educational experience.
On the other hand, Crow considers Sesame Street a beautiful model of what I call high-tech learning. They can teach children about letters, numbers, color and size through repetition in ways traditional education can t, and provide early information about attitudes, values and relationships.
